In the 13th episode of the NHK nighttime drama "Radio Star" (NHK General TV), starring actress Momoko Fukuchi, airing on April 20th at 11 PM, the show invites artisans of Wajima lacquerware and Suzu pottery to the studio to hear about their dedication to their craft. Kanade (Fukuchi) is moved to tears by what she hears.
"Radio Star" is a nonstop entertainment drama set in Noto, depicting how an ordinary citizen becomes a star. The theme song is "A Boat Full of Happiness," written and composed by Yumi Matsutoya and sung by MISIA.
In the 13th episode, Rikuto (Shoma Kai), who has joined Radio Star, immediately comes up with a plan called the "Japonism Championship." He invites artisans of Wajima lacquerware and Suzu ware, traditional crafts from Oku-Noto, to the studio to hear about their dedication to their craft. Kanade is moved to tears by the artisans' perspectives on life.
Kanade begins to tell Rikuto that when she lived in the city, she always felt like she was being chased by something. Kanade wishes she could stay in this place a little longer.
